13 Facts About Channing Dungey

1.

Channing Nicole Dungey was born on March 14,1969 and is an American television executive and the first black American president of a major broadcast television network.

2.

Channing Dungey is the older of two daughters; her younger sister is actress Merrin Dungey.

3.

In 1991, Channing Dungey graduated from the UCLA School of Theater, Film and Television.

4.

Channing Dungey joined Disney's ABC Studios in the summer of 2004, later becoming head of drama.

5.

Channing Dungey was appointed president of ABC Entertainment on February 17,2016, replacing Paul Lee.

6.

Channing Dungey oversaw the development of ABC Studios shows such as Scandal, How to Get Away with Murder, Nashville, Quantico, Army Wives, and Once Upon a Time.

7.

Channing Dungey was ABC Entertainment's president when a Black-ish episode was pulled from the schedule.

8.

Channing Dungey noted ABC executives disagreed with the creative direction of the episode, wherein the writers touched on NFL players kneeling during the American national anthem to protest police brutality and show support for Black human rights.

9.

On November 16,2018, Channing Dungey left her role as President of the ABC Entertainment Group in advance of management changes triggered by Disney's takeover of 21st Century Fox.

10.

Channing Dungey worked with fellow ABC alums Shonda Rhimes and Kenya Barris at Netflix.

11.

On October 19,2020, it was announced that Channing Dungey would succeed Peter Roth in the position of chairwoman of Warner Bros.

12.

Channing Dungey has been listed annually among The Hollywood Reporter's "Women in Entertainment Power 100", since its 25th list of 2016, and to Variety's annual 500 Most Important People in Global Media, since it began in 2017.

13.

Channing Dungey became an honorary member of Delta Sigma Theta sorority in 2023.
